Dismas the Good Thief

Dismas is the traditional name for the "good thief," one of the two criminals crucified beside Jesus. In Luke's Gospel he rebukes the other condemned man, admits his own guilt, and asks only to be remembered — receiving the answer, "Today you will be with me in Paradise." He is honored as the patron of prisoners and the condemned, and endures as the Church's emblem of grace granted at the eleventh hour.
